MADRID, 21 Dic. (EUROPA PRESS) -

The president of France, Emmanuel Macron, has declared himself a "great admirer" of the French actor Gérard Depardieu, accused of sexual violence, and has denied that he is going to withdraw the Legion of Honor, the "highest honor" granted by the French Executive and award for merits performed in the name of the nation.

"I am a great admirer of Depardieu, he is a great actor. A genius of all his art, he made France known throughout the world," he declared in an interview in which he asserted that the actor "makes France proud" and He lamented that "sometimes there are outbursts."

Culture Minister Rima Abdul Malak announced on Friday a disciplinary procedure that could lead to the withdrawal of the Legion of Honor. Macron pointed out this Wednesday that the minister had gone "too far", since, according to him, the award "is not here to preach".

"I hate human persecution," declared the French head of state, who has asked that Depardieu's "presumption of innocence" be respected and has indicated that "the legal procedures will continue." "We do not take away the Legion of Honor from an artist for a report (...) At that price, we would have taken (the award) away from many artists," he stated.

The president has stressed that, "if every time someone accuses you of the worst and you have a public role, you can no longer do anything, it is an air of suspicion, it is no longer democracy. We are no longer free citizens." "If he is subsequently convicted, at that moment the proceeding will be made," he added.

In recent months, Gérard Depardieu has received various accusations of sexual violence against thirteen women, during the filming of eleven films released between 2004 and 2022, according to the French newspaper 'Mediapart' last April.

Recently, on December 7, the French actress Hélène Darras denounced the actor for sexual assault in the 2007 film 'Disco'. The actress claims that Depardieu's behavior was "ungovernable" and details that he proposed to go to her dressing room, to which she refused, although that did not stop the actor from continuing to "grope" her.

On the other hand, the Spanish journalist and writer Ruth Baza presented this week to the Torremolinos (Málaga) police a complaint of rape against the actor Gérard Depardieu for events that occurred in Paris in 1995. The complaint includes what happened during the interview with the actor for the magazine 'Cinemanía', when the reporter was 23 years old and it was the premiere of the film 'Colonel Chabert'.
